AI Item Analysis

This is a premium men's or unisex box chain necklace, highly characteristic of the heritage designs by David Yurman. The piece is constructed from sterling silver, featuring a substantial gauge with distinctive square-shaped interlocking links that create a rounded, structural appearance. The links exhibit a significant amount of antiqued oxidation in the recessed areas, which provides high-contrast depth and highlights the metallic luster of the outer surfaces. The necklace is secured by a specialized lobster claw or push-lock clasp flanked by two decorative, ridged end caps—a hallmark of Yurman craftsmanship often referred to as 'cabled' or 'banded' detailing. The overall construction suggests high-quality density and weight. In terms of condition, there is visible surface patina and minor scuffing consistent with regular wear, but no apparent structural damage or broken links are visible. Based on the style, it likely dates from the late 20th or early 21st century. The metallic finish remains bright despite the intentional darkening, indicating well-maintained precious metal composition.

AI Appraisal Report

I have conducted a visual appraisal of this David Yurman sterling silver box chain necklace. The piece exhibits the classic 4mm or 5mm gauge characteristic of the brand's masculine/unisex line. The links show a healthy weight, and the oxidation is consistent with authentic pieces, highlighting the deep-set recessed areas of the box links. The hardware, featuring the signature banded end caps and high-polish push-clasp, appears consistent with genuine manufacture. The condition is rated as 'Good to Very Good'; common surface micro-scratches and minor patina are present, but these are expected for a pre-owned designer item and do not detract from the structural integrity. The market for David Yurman remains robust, with strong resale demand for the classic box chain due to its versatility and brand recognition. Comparables on the secondary market for this specific gauge generally fall within the $400 to $700 range. A significant factor in this valuation is the chain's length, which I am estimating at 20-24 inches. Note that while this visual assessment looks promising, it is not a guarantee of authenticity. A full authentication requires an in-person physical inspection to verify the hallmark stamps (e.g., 'DY' and '925'), a weight check in grams to ensure it matches production standards, and an acid or XRF test to confirm the silver purity. The presence of original packaging or a purchase receipt would further support the upper end of the valuation range.
